Portuguese
edit
Etymology
edit
From
cabelo
+
-eira
.

Hyphenation:
ca‧be‧lei‧ra
Noun
edit
cabeleira
f
(
plural
cabeleiras
)
hair
,
head of hair
(
especially long and voluminous
)
